WebJan 19, 2024 · Interest income. Interest on deposits with banks operating in Greece and interest from Greek bonds and treasury bills are subject to income tax at the rate of 15%, and this tax is withheld at source with exhaustion of any further income tax liability. Non-residents are exempt from the WHT where the deposit is kept in foreign currency. WebJan 19, 2024 · Foreign income. Resident corporations are taxed on their worldwide income. Foreign income received by a domestic corporation is taxed together with other income. If related income tax is paid or withheld abroad, a tax credit is generally available up to the amount of the applicable Greek income tax. Losses from foreign sources may not be set ... WebMar 22, 2024 · With the provision of article 298 of law 4738/2024, with which paragraph 50 was added to article 72 of law 4172/2013, Greek solidarity tax has been abolished for … WebSep 29, 2024 · Greece published Law No. 4972/2024 in the Official Gazette on 23 September 2024, which contains various measures including certain tax measures. One of the main measures is the repeal of the special solidarity contribution on individuals for all income from 1 January 2024.

Should the taxable income from employment and pensions exceed the amount of … WebOct 7, 2024 · Greece reduced the top personal income tax rate from 55 to 54 percent (44 percent income tax plus 10 percent solidarity surcharge) in 2024. In 2024, the solidarity surcharge was suspended for all types of income, other than income from public sector employment and pensions. The top rate applies to income exceeding €40,000 (US …
